According to research released by ticket-comparison site Ticket-Compare.com, the Titans have one of the emptiest stadiums in the NFL, this season. As of Sept. 22, the team is averaging more than 11,000 empty seats per home game, according to the study, resulting in an estimated $1.9 million in lost revenue per game.
